The Genesis of Arbitrage

Arbitrage is not a new concept; it has been practiced for centuries in various forms. Its roots can be traced back to the Dutch East India Company in the 17th century when traders exploited price differences in various ports to make substantial profits. Since then, arbitrage has evolved significantly, thanks to advancements in technology and the globalization of financial markets.

Traditional Arbitrage Strategies

Before delving into the technology aspect, let's explore some traditional arbitrage strategies that have been employed historically:

1. Spatial Arbitrage

Spatial arbitrage involves taking benefit of price differences in the same asset in different geographic locations. For instance, a trader might buy a commodity in one market where it's undervalued and sell it in another where it's overvalued, profiting from the price differential.

2. Temporal Arbitrage

Temporal arbitrage is all about exploiting price differences over time. 3. Statistical Arbitrage

Statistical arbitrage, often referred to as "stat arb," relies on quantitative models and statistical analysis to identify and profit from price deviations from historical trends or correlations between assets.

The Technological Revolution

The advent of technology, particularly in the 21st century, has revolutionized arbitrage strategies. Here are some ways in which technology has transformed the landscape:

1. High-Frequency Trading (HFT)

High-frequency trading is perhaps the most notable technological advancement in arbitrage. HFT firms use prevailing computers and algorithms to execute thousands of trades per second, exploiting even the tiniest price differences. The speed at which these trades are executed is beyond human capability and has drastically reduced the window of opportunity for manual traders.

2. Algorithmic Trading

Algorithmic trading encompasses a wide range of strategies, including arbitrage. These algorithms can scan multiple markets simultaneously, looking for arbitrage opportunities and executing trades within milliseconds. Read More: thetechiesvision

3. Machine Learning and AI

Machine learning and artificial intelligence have enabled traders to develop more sophisticated models for arbitrage. These systems can analyze vast datasets, identify patterns, and make decisions in real-time, often adapting to changing market conditions.

4. Connectivity and Data Feeds

The availability of high-speed internet and real-time data feeds from various exchanges worldwide has made it possible for traders to access pricing information instantly, further enhancing their ability to spot arbitrage opportunities.

Arbitrage in Financial Markets

Arbitrage is not limited to traditional markets like commodities or foreign exchange; it has seeped into various financial markets as well. Here are some examples:

1. Equity Markets

In equity markets, arbitrage opportunities can arise due to differences in stock prices between different exchanges, often driven by liquidity imbalances or delays in information dissemination.

2. Cryptocurrency Markets

3. Fixed-Income Markets

Fixed-income arbitrage involves trading bonds, and it relies on discrepancies in yield spreads, interest rates, or credit risk between different bonds or markets.

Challenges and Risks

While technology has undoubtedly improved the competence and profitability of arbitrage strategies, it has also introduced new challenges and risks:

1. Competition

The proliferation of technology has attracted more participants to the arbitrage game, increasing competition and reducing profit margins.

2. Market Volatility

The speed at which arbitrage trades are executed means that traders are exposed to heightened market volatility, and rapid price movements can lead to significant losses.

3. Regulatory Scrutiny

Regulators are closely monitoring high-frequency and algorithmic trading, imposing rules to ensure market stability and fairness.

4. Technological Glitches

In the world of HFT, a minor technological glitch can result in substantial losses. The "flash crash" of 2010 is a prime example of how technology can amplify market disruptions.
